// DARKMODE_PALETTE_VERSION
//
// Controls which token set the Opsboard admin dashboard loads for dark mode.
// Bumping this invalidates cached CSS on every client — do not change it
// without coordinating with the Glimmer design-tokens repo, or reviewers
// will see mismatched contrast ratios in the audit screenshots.
// Versions 1–3 are retired; 4 adds the high-contrast variant required by
// the accessibility pass. Keep this in sync with the tokens manifest.
// The generating build is recorded on the line below.

pipeline stamp: htk31_f769b577b3028a4e9958e5bb8d1259a

To the heads of department: as I transfer responsibilities to Director Maren Olloway, I want to document our exposure carefully. Roughly 61% of recurring revenue for the Bricklaw platform sits with a single account, Tellerfen Group, whose contract renews in Q3. Mitigation work is underway — the Ashvale pipeline now holds nine qualified mid-tier prospects — but diversification will take at least two quarters. Treat renewal terms as the top commercial priority. The strategic context is summarised in the confidential line below.

board note of kageg-bahof: The renewal with Holwynax Holdings closes at $2 million a year, 5 percent below the last contract. Project Ulaath slips by two quarters because of the supplier delay.

## Break-Glass Access: Flagwright Rollout Framework

New team members should read this before joining the on-call rotation. Flagwright controls staged feature-flag rollouts across all Nimbard services. In an emergency — for example, a bad flag causing widespread errors while the control plane is down — break-glass access lets you force-disable flags directly at the edge. Every break-glass use pages the platform lead and opens an incident automatically. To activate the emergency override console, enter the recovery passphrase below.

recovery phrase for baweg-faweg: zorael-framir